Output 8bdafacc6d6e523f73728861898ba12cc5378b61ae5db0f74ef35ac2eaf397aa:1

value
498311864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95d03077557e02bc5ac7597b906b186d4e93f53d OP_EQUALVERIFY OP_CHECKSIG
address
1Ef95qAGUVbL2EZZHWDyX2C9VxXVpwfStS
transaction
8bdafacc6d6e523f73728861898ba12cc5378b61ae5db0f74ef35ac2eaf397aa
spent
true